Summary

An Act to renumber 77.54 (6); to renumber and amend 77.54 (6r); and to create 77.54 (6) (am) 4., 77.54 (6) (am) 5. and 77.54 (6) (bn) of the statutes; Relating to: the sales and use tax exemption for equipment used in a fertilizer blending, feed milling, or grain drying operation. (FE)
